An adolescent intensive outpatient program, or adolescent IOP, is an outpatient treatment for teens that helps them break free from substance abuse, harmful behaviors, or mental health concerns. Adolescence is often the first time people experiment with drugs or alcohol or find themselves struggling with mental health. It also marks a critical period where lasting change can occur.
